Important information about the ECO range

These machines are designed for simple applications that do not generate large impurities or a lot of dust. They are not equipped with a sieve to recover large impurities, nor a cyclone to remove dust and recycle abrasive (PRO range only). 

ECO range blast cabinets operate with a injection/succion system

Simple to use, with easy adjustment and maintenance, this system uses the Venturi effect to project the abrasive onto the surface to be treated. 

Vacuum abrasive spraying is ideal for basic applications where high intensity is not required, and for treating surfaces by sandblasting or microblasting.

CHOOSING THE RIGHT NOZZLE DIAMETER FOR YOUR COMPRESSOR

Pressure system

Inside Ø nozzleØ 4 mmØ 5 mmØ 6 mmØ 8 mm**
Air consumption (for P = 5 bar)55 m³/h85 m³/h114 m³/h202 m³/h
Minimum power required for a screw compressor 10 ch / 7,5 kW15 ch / 11 kW20 ch / 15 kW30 ch / 22 kW


Injection / Succion system 

Inside Ø nozzleØ 5 mmØ 6 mmØ 8 mmØ 10 mm
Air consumption (for P = 5 bar)19 m³/h27 m³/h48 m³/h75 m³/h
Minimum power required for a piston compressor4 ch / 3 kW10 ch / 7,5 kW15 ch / 11 kW/
Minimum power required for a screw compressor4 ch / 3 kW7,5 ch / 5,5 kW10 ch / 7,5 kW15 ch / 11 kW

⚠️ Indicative values at 5 bar. Air consumption varies with the blasting pressure: refer to the compressed air consumption table to adjust the compressor power to your working pressure.*Excluding cumulative consumption of other machines connected to your compressed air network. To ensure optimal performance, make sure the piping diameter is adequate throughout the installation. Nozzle wear also increases air consumption.
